    Police are still combing through information they've received in the hunt for the killer of Ashburton schoolgirl Kirsty Bentley


    The 1998 murder of the 15-year-old remains one of New Zealand's most high-profile cold cases.

    About 80 tips - regarding people, vehicles, and events - have been sent in since a 100-thousand dollar reward was posted in late July.

    Detective Inspector Greg Murton says some were random sightings and many require a lot of digging to contact all relevant parties.

    Nothing obvious has emerged yet.
